Performance Specifications
Both smartphones carry the same features apart from the ones mentioned above. The overall design, the camera setup, the software, RAM, storage, and even the chipset is the same. The smartphones will come with Snapdragon Gen 2 chipset, which is the most powerful chipset at the moment.
The Gen 2 chipset will be paired with the Red Magic R2 chip for enhanced gaming effects, better colors, improved sound details, haptic vibration feedback, and touch sensitivity. The cooling system of the smartphone has been updated as well.
While the base Red Magic Pro starts at 8GB RAM and 128 GB storage and goes up to 12GB RAM and 256GB storage, the Pro Plus model starts at 12GB of RAM and 256 GB of storage and goes all the way to a 16GB RAM and 1 TB storage model.
Other than that, both nubia models feature the same specs and both will be available with a transparent back in a special edition.
The nubia Red Magic 8 Pro specs include the Snapdragon 8 Gen 2 chipset with a red Magic R2 chip designed for gaming, which improves graphics and touch sensitivity and handles haptic vibration.
The Red Magic 8 Pro has a 6.8-inch AMOLED Full HD+ display with 120Hz refresh rate and 960Hz max touch sampling rate and, just like the previous model, sports a 16 MP selfie cam under it.
On the back, you have a 50MP sensor, a 8MP ultra-wide-snapper and a 2MP macro sensor, a decent setup for a gaming phone.
Still, since it’s a gaming phone, the notable specs are not the camera.
Instead, the interesting design choices are related to cooling.
The Red Magic 8 Pro comes with multiple layers of graphite sheets for cooling, a 3D vapor chamber and a 20,000 RPM side fan, so long gaming sessions won’t affect the temperature of this device.
You also have two shoulder keys for the touch sampling and a hard trigger that starts gaming mode, plus a 3.5mm headphone jack so you can connect your favorite gaming headset.
The Nubia Red Magic 8 Pro line-up retails starting at CNY5,199, which translates to about $750.
